Krohn-Hite 3202 Low-Pass Filter Calibration

Quick Overview

  • What it is: Dual-channel, switch-selectable, low-pass analog filter
  • Typical use: Signal conditioning, waveform shaping, noise filtering, laboratory and research electronic measurements
  • Status: Discontinued (may be available used or refurbished)

FAQ

Calibration frequency depends on your organization's QMS (quality management system) and the criticality of use, but typically once every 12 months (annually) is recommended for laboratory electronic filters.

If the device is used in accredited or traceable measurements, calibration is due:
- When calibration date has expired per calibration label or documentation
- After any repairs or major mechanical/electrical shocks
- If output performance drifts or measurement errors are suspected
- At intervals set by your lab’s quality procedures (typically 1 year)
